diff --git a/Wave/Components/Account/Pages/Manage/Partials/AboutMeFormPartial.razor b/Wave/Components/Account/Pages/Manage/Partials/AboutMeFormPartial.razor
index ff44d11..31aae03 100644
--- a/Wave/Components/Account/Pages/Manage/Partials/AboutMeFormPartial.razor
+++ b/Wave/Components/Account/Pages/Manage/Partials/AboutMeFormPartial.razor
@@ -40,21 +40,26 @@
@Localizer["Submit"]
+
+
+ @Localizer["Profile_Link_Label"]
+
@code {
[Parameter]
- public required ApplicationUser? User { get; set; }
+ public required ApplicationUser User { get; set; }
[SupplyParameterFromForm(FormName = "about-me")]
private InputModel Model { get; set; } = new();
protected override void OnInitialized() {
- Model.AboutTheAuthor ??= User?.AboutTheAuthor;
- Model.Biography ??= User?.Biography;
+ Model.AboutTheAuthor ??= User.AboutTheAuthor;
+ Model.Biography ??= User.Biography;
}
private async Task OnValidSubmit(EditContext obj) {
- if (User is null) return;
if (Model.Biography is not null) {
User.BiographyHtml = MarkdownUtilities.Parse(Model.Biography);
User.Biography = Model.Biography;
diff --git a/Wave/Components/ArticleComponent.razor b/Wave/Components/ArticleComponent.razor
index 15730f6..c0d80d2 100644
--- a/Wave/Components/ArticleComponent.razor
+++ b/Wave/Components/ArticleComponent.razor
@@ -44,25 +44,31 @@
@if (!string.IsNullOrWhiteSpace(Article.Author.AboutTheAuthor)) {
-
- @Article.Author.AboutTheAuthor
-
+ @Article.Author.AboutTheAuthor
+ About The Author
- @Article.Author.Name
- About The Author
+ @Article.Author.Name
+
@Localizer["NotFound_Description"]
+ @Localizer["NotFound_BackToHome_Label"] +} else { +@User.AboutTheAuthor
+